Researchers from University of Tsukuba in collaboration with Yamagata University scientists find that exposure to light with less blue before sleep is better for energy metabolism

Tsukuba, Japan—Extended exposure to light during nighttime can have negative consequences for human health. But now, researchers from Japan have identified a new type of light with reduced consequences for physiological changes during sleep.

In a study published in June 2021 in Scientific Reports, researchers from University of Tsukuba compared the effects of light-emitting diodes (LEDs), which have been widely adopted for their energy-saving properties, with organic light-emitting diodes (OLEDs) on physical processes that occur during sleep.

Polychromatic white LEDs emit a large amount of blue light, which has been linked with many negative health effects, including metabolic health. In contrast, OLEDs emit polychromatic white light that contains less blue light. However, the impact of LED and OLED exposure at night has not been compared in terms of changes in energy metabolism during sleep, something the researchers at University of Tsukuba aimed to address.

Long COVID More than a quarter of COVID19 patients still symptomatic after 6 months - کووید طولانی مشکلی شایع

In a new study of adults from the general population who were infected with COVID-19 in 2020, more than a quarter report not having fully recovered after six to eight months. Those findings are described in the open-access journal PLOS ONE.

In the new study, researchers recruited 431 participants from within the contact tracing system in Zurich, Switzerland. All participants had tested positive for SARS-CoV-2 between February and August 2020, and completed an online questionnaire about their health a median of 7.2 months after their diagnosis. Symptoms had been present at diagnosis in 89% of the participants and 19% were initially hospitalized. Compared to individuals not participating in the study, participants were younger–with an average age of 47.

Overall, 26% of participants reported that they had not fully recovered at six to eight months after initial COVID-19 diagnosis. 55% reported symptoms of fatigue, 25% had some degree of shortness of breath, and 26% had symptoms of depression. A higher percentage of females and initially hospitalized patients reported not having recovered compared to males and non-hospitalized individuals. A total of 40% of participants reported at least one general practitioner visit related to COVID-19 after their acute illness. The authors say that their findings underscore the need for the timely planning of resources and patient services for post-COVID-19 care.

Fibromyalgia likely the result of autoimmune problems - فیبرومیالژیا یک بیماری خودایمنی

The King’s-led study, in collaboration with University of Liverpool and the Karolinska Institute, shows that many of the symptoms in fibromyalgia syndrome are caused by antibodies increasing the activity of pain-sensing nerves.

New research from the Institute of Psychiatry, Psychology & Neuroscience (IoPPN) at King’s College London, in collaboration with the University of Liverpool and the Karolinska Institute, has shown that many of the symptoms in fibromyalgia syndrome (FMS) are caused by antibodies that increase the activity of pain-sensing nerves throughout the body.

The results show that fibromyalgia is a disease of the immune system, rather than the currently held view that it originates in the brain.

The study, published today in the Journal of Clinical Investigation, demonstrates that the increased pain sensitivity, muscle weakness, reduced movement, and reduced number of small nerve-fibres in the skin that are typical of FMS, are all a consequence of patient antibodies.

Consuming a diet with more fish fats less vegetable oils can reduce migraine headaches - رژیم غذایی و میگرن

A diet higher in fatty fish helped frequent migraine sufferers reduce their monthly number of headaches and intensity of pain compared to participants on a diet higher in vegetable-based fats and oils, according to a new study. The findings by a team of researchers from the National Institute on Aging (NIA) and the National Institute on Alcohol Abuse and Alcoholism (NIAAA), parts of the National Institutes of Health (NIH); and the University of North Carolina (UNC), Chapel Hill, were published in The BMJ.

The NIH team was led by Chris Ramsden, a clinical investigator in the NIA and NIAAA intramural research programs, and a UNC adjunct faculty member. Ramsden and his team specialize in the study of lipids — fatty acid compounds found in many natural oils — and their role in aging, especially chronic pain and neurodegenerative conditions.

Cancer cells eat themselves to survive - خودخوری سلول های سرطانی

To survive life threatening injuries, cancer cells use a technique in which they eat parts of the membrane surrounding them. This is shown for the first time in research from a team of Danish researchers.

It is the membrane of cancer cells that is at the focus of the new research now showing a completely new way in which cancer cells can repair the damage that can otherwise kill them.

In both normal cells and cancer cells, the cell membrane acts as the skin of the cells. And damage to the membrane can be life threatening. The interior of cells is fluid, and if a hole is made in the membrane, the cell simply floats out and dies – a bit like a hole in a water balloon.

Therefore, damage to the cell membrane must be repaired quickly, and now research from a team of Danish researchers shows that cancer cells use a technique called macropinocytosis. The technique, which is already a known tool for cells in other contexts, consists in the cancer cells pulling the intact cell membrane in over the damaged area and sealing the hole in a matter of minutes. Next, the damaged part of the cell membrane is separated into small spheres and transported to the cells’ ‘stomach’ – the so-called lysosomes, where they are broken down.

Changes in Wealth Tied to Changes In Cardiovascular Health - ثروت و سلامت قلب و عروق

Longitudinal study of healthy adults finds upward or downward changes in wealth were associated with respective lower or higher levels of cardiovascular events

A new study by investigators from Brigham and Women’s Hospital examines the associations between wealth mobility and long-term cardiovascular health. The multidisciplinary study borrowed methodology from the field of economics to analyze longitudinal changes in wealth. The team’s results indicate that negative wealth mobility is associated with an increased risk of cardiovascular events, while positive wealth changes are associated with a decreased risk of cardiovascular events. Their results are published in JAMA Cardiology.

Impulsiveness tied to faster eating in children can lead to obesity - تکانشگری از علل چاقی کودکان

Children who eat slower are less likely to be extroverted and impulsive, according to a new study co-led by the University at Buffalo and Children’s Hospital of Philadelphia.

The research, which sought to uncover the relationship between temperament and eating behaviors in early childhood, also found that kids who were highly responsive to external food cues (the urge to eat when food is seen, smelled or tasted) were more likely to experience frustration and discomfort and have difficulties self-soothing.

These findings are critical because faster eating and greater responsiveness to food cues have been linked to obesity risk in children, says Myles Faith, PhD, co-author and professor of counseling, school and educational psychology in the UB Graduate School of Education.

Moderna and Pfizer BioNTech vaccines prime T cells to fight SARS CoV 2 variants - اثربخشی واکسن علیه گونه های جدید کرونا

Researchers at La Jolla Institute for Immunology (LJI) have found that T cells from people who have recovered from COVID-19 or received the Moderna or Pfizer-BioNTech vaccines are still able to recognize several concerning SARS-CoV-2 variants.

Their new study, published in Cell Reports Medicine, shows that both CD4+ “helper” T cells and CD8+ “killer” T cells can still recognize mutated forms of the virus. This reactivity is key to the body’s complex immune response to the virus, which allows the body to kill infected cells and stop severe infections.

Updated analysis of US COVID19 deaths shows drops disparities in average lifespans - کرونا و امید به زندگی

In the US, COVID-19 reduced overall life expectancy by over 1.3 years, with the effects on Black and Latino populations 2 to 3 times those for the white population.

The updated analysis, which included the more than 380,000 US COVID-19 deaths in 2020 and used 2018 life expectancies as a comparison, indicates that COVID-19 reduced overall life expectancy by 1.31 years (up from the initial estimate of 1.13 years lost) to 77.43 years. The reductions in average lifespan are more than three times as large for Latinos (3.03 years) and twice as large for the Black population (1.90 years) compared to whites (0.94 years). How a corona infection changes blood cells in the long run - تاثیر درازمدت کرونا بر سلول های خونی

Using real-time deformability cytometry, researchers at the Max-Planck-Zentrum für Physik und Medizin in Erlangen were able to show for the first time: Covid-19 significantly changes the size and stiffness of red and white blood cells – sometimes over months. These results may help to explain why some affected people continue to complain of symptoms long after an infection (long covid).

Shortness of breath, fatigue and headaches: some patients still struggle with the long-term effects of a severe infection by the SARS-CoV-2 coronavirus after six months or more. This post Covid-19 syndrome, also called long covid, is still not properly understood. What is clear is that — during the course of the disease — often blood circulation is impaired, dangerous vascular occlusions can occur and oxygen transport in is limited. These are all phenomena in which the blood cells and their physical properties play a key role.

The research group has now published their results in the renowned journal “Biophysical Journal“.
